Processing

Please wait...

Settings

Settings

Goto Application

1. US20200175217 - PARALLEL PROCESSOR DATA PROCESSING SYSTEM WITH REDUCED LATENCY

Office United States of America
Application Number 16695504
Application Date 26.11.2019
Publication Number 20200175217
Publication Date 04.06.2020
Publication Kind A1
IPC
G06F 30/28
GPHYSICS
06COMPUTING; CALCULATING OR COUNTING
FELECTRIC DIGITAL DATA PROCESSING
30Computer-aided design
20Design optimisation, verification or simulation
28using fluid dynamics, e.g. using Navier-Stokes equations or computational fluid dynamics
G06F 9/38
GPHYSICS
06COMPUTING; CALCULATING OR COUNTING
FELECTRIC DIGITAL DATA PROCESSING
9Arrangements for program control, e.g. control units
06using stored programs, i.e. using an internal store of processing equipment to receive or retain programs
30Arrangements for executing machine instructions, e.g. instruction decode
38Concurrent instruction execution, e.g. pipeline, look ahead
G01N 25/18
GPHYSICS
01MEASURING; TESTING
NINVESTIGATING OR ANALYSING MATERIALS BY DETERMINING THEIR CHEMICAL OR PHYSICAL PROPERTIES
25Investigating or analysing materials by the use of thermal means
18by investigating thermal conductivity
G01V 99/00
GPHYSICS
01MEASURING; TESTING
VGEOPHYSICS; GRAVITATIONAL MEASUREMENTS; DETECTING MASSES OR OBJECTS; TAGS
99Subject matter not provided for in other groups of this subclass
G06F 17/13
GPHYSICS
06COMPUTING; CALCULATING OR COUNTING
FELECTRIC DIGITAL DATA PROCESSING
17Digital computing or data processing equipment or methods, specially adapted for specific functions
10Complex mathematical operations
11for solving equations
13Differential equations
CPC
G06F 9/3885
GPHYSICS
06COMPUTING; CALCULATING; COUNTING
FELECTRIC DIGITAL DATA PROCESSING
9Arrangements for program control, e.g. control units
06using stored programs, i.e. using an internal store of processing equipment to receive or retain programs
30Arrangements for executing machine instructions, e.g. instruction decode
38Concurrent instruction execution, e.g. pipeline, look ahead
3885using a plurality of independent parallel functional units
G06F 30/28
GPHYSICS
06COMPUTING; CALCULATING; COUNTING
FELECTRIC DIGITAL DATA PROCESSING
30Computer-aided design [CAD]
20Design optimisation, verification or simulation
28using fluid dynamics, e.g. using Navier-Stokes equations or computational fluid dynamics [CFD]
G06F 17/13
GPHYSICS
06COMPUTING; CALCULATING; COUNTING
FELECTRIC DIGITAL DATA PROCESSING
17Digital computing or data processing equipment or methods, specially adapted for specific functions
10Complex mathematical operations
11for solving equations ; , e.g. nonlinear equations, general mathematical optimization problems
13Differential equations
G01V 99/005
GPHYSICS
01MEASURING; TESTING
VGEOPHYSICS; GRAVITATIONAL MEASUREMENTS; DETECTING MASSES OR OBJECTS
99Subject matter not provided for in other groups of this subclass
005Geomodels or geomodelling, not related to particular measurements
G01N 25/18
GPHYSICS
01MEASURING; TESTING
NINVESTIGATING OR ANALYSING MATERIALS BY DETERMINING THEIR CHEMICAL OR PHYSICAL PROPERTIES
25Investigating or analyzing materials by the use of thermal means
18by investigating thermal conductivity
Applicants SAUDI ARABIAN OIL COMPANY
MASSACHUSETTS INSTITUTE OF TECHNOLOGY
Inventors Maitham Makki Alhubail
John R. Williams
Qiqi Wang
Ali Dogru
Usuf Middya
Title
(EN) PARALLEL PROCESSOR DATA PROCESSING SYSTEM WITH REDUCED LATENCY
Abstract
(EN)

A data processing system systems with parallel processors performing simulations by numerical solution of partial differential equations or similar numerical simulations. The data processing system extends the scaling limit of parallel solvers in those numerical simulations by overcoming the frequent network latencies encountered during a simulation. Fewer, yet larger batches of data are exchanged between computing nodes.

Also published as